A fire broke out in Vancouver’s Plaza of Nations on Monday night, prompting a police investigation. Videos from the scene taken at approximately 7:45 p.m. showed large flames outside of a building, very close to where boats were moored in the harbour. Flames and smoke could be seen billowing into the sky around False Creek. Vancouver Fire and Rescue Services said the there was no structural damage and that no one was injured. “Crews arrived on scene quickly and knocked down the fire confining it to the outside of the structure,” an emailed statement to CTV News said. The Vancouver Police Department is investigating the fire as a “possible arson” a spokesperson said in a statement, adding that officers were canvassing for witnesses and CCTV video. No suspects have been identified.
